Structural Beam Installation sets LVL, PSL, or steel beams to carry the load when a wall is removed or a large opening is framed, sized by an engineer and built to the Ontario Building Code. Timberr Framing frames Guelph structural beam installation straight from your architectural and engineered drawings — reading the spans, headers, beam sizes, and load paths off the permit set and building to them exactly. The crew coordinates with your engineer, architect, and general contractor so every LVL, beam pocket, and bearing point matches the stamped plans, and the Guelph build is left ready for the framing inspection with nothing left to guesswork.
